California Lutheran University vs. Umary Cost Comparison

Which college is more expensive, California Lutheran University or Umary?

  • California Lutheran University is 161.4% more expensive to attend than Umary for in-state tuition ($49,880.00 vs. $19,084.00)
  • Out of state tuition is 161.4% higher at California Lutheran University than University of Mary ($49,880.00 vs. $19,084.00)
  • The typical actual cost that students pay to attend (average net price) is less at University of Mary than California Lutheran University ($19,225 vs. $27,080)
  • Living costs (room and board or off-campus housing budget) at University of Mary are 108.5% lower than costs at California Lutheran University ($8,506 vs. $17,734)
  • The same percent of students receive financial grant aid at California Lutheran University as University of Mary (100% vs. 100%)
  • The average total grant financial aid received by California Lutheran University students is 168.5% larger than aid received University of Mary ($36,687 vs. $13,664)

California Lutheran University vs. Umary Graduation Outcomes Comparison

Which is better, California Lutheran University or Umary? Graduation rate, salary and amount of student loan debt are indicators of a college which offers better outcomes for its graduates. Compare the following outcomes facts between Umary and California Lutheran University.

  • The graduation rate at California Lutheran University is higher than University of Mary (64% vs. 52%)
  • Graduates from California Lutheran University earn on average $6,000 more per year than Umary graduates after ten years. ($57,900 vs. $51,900)
  • University of Mary students graduate with a $500 lower median federal student loan debt than California Lutheran University graduates. ($22,500 vs. $23,000)
  • Umary graduates are paying $5 less per month on federal student loans than California Lutheran University graduates. ($232 vs. $237)
  • More Umary graduates are actively paying back their federal student loan debt than former California Lutheran University students, three years after graduation. (76% vs. 70%)
